This beautiful notebook features inspiring characters from Kiki's Delivery Service, Studio Ghibli's beloved fantasy film about a young witch finding her way in the world.

With a cloth-bound, foil-stamped case, lined pages, and lay-flat binding, this notebook invites you to let your creativity take flight, like Kiki! Perfect for writers, notetakers, collectors, and animation fans alike.

LUXE FORMAT NOTEBOOK: Distinctive and durable cloth-bound hardcover with foil stamping, full-color endsheets, and lined pages. Measures 6 x 8 inches, 128 pages, 140 GSM woodfree FSC-certified paper, and is nicely sized for all types of work and for carrying along in a backpack or tote.

LAY-FLAT BINDING: This notebook lays flat for ease of writing.

BELOVED STUDIO WITH MASSIVE FAN BASE WORLDWIDE: The Ghibli Museum, Mitaka and Ghibli Park are popular destinations in Japan. The studio won the Academy Award (R) for Best Animated Feature for Spirited Away and The Boy and the Heron and earned Academy Award (R) nominations for Howl's Moving Castle, The Wind Rises, The Tale of The Princess Kaguya, When Marnie Was There, and The Red Turtle.
